Minimum Qualifications:
- Experience: 7+ years' related experience. 2 years' supervisory experience in an aerospace industry; Demonstrated experience with relevant aerospace standards and practices; Demonstrated strong customer orientation
- Deep understanding of embedded systems: Proficiency in programming languages like C and C++. Knowledge of communication interfaces (SPI, I2C, CAN).
- Experience with Aerospace standards and audits: Expertise in planning, test/validation, analyzing and managing software requirements and configuration in accordance with RTCA DO-178, DO-330, DO-331, DO-297.
- Experience with Integrated Modular Avionics (IMA): including
- System Architecture Design: Proficiency in designing and developing modular avionics architectures.
- Software Integration: Expertise in integrating multiple software applications on shared hardware platforms.
- Communication Protocols: In-depth knowledge of avionics communication protocols (e.g., ARINC 653, ARINC 429, AFDX).
- Safety and Certification: Understanding of safety-critical software development and certification processes, including RTCA DO-297.
- Performance Optimization: Skills in optimizing system performance, including timing analysis and resource allocation.
- Testing and Validation: Proficiency in developing and executing test plans, including HIL and SIL testing methodologies.
- Troubleshooting and Debugging: Strong problem-solving skills for diagnosing and resolving issues in IMA systems.
- Planning: Ability to develop and execute detailed project plans.
